The Transformation PMO Lead is responsible for driving governance, delivery discipline, and performance tracking across a portfolio of strategic transformation initiatives, ensuring outcomes are delivered on time, on budget, and aligned to business objectives.
Key Responsibilities
- Establish and lead the Transformation PMO, including governance, standards, and reporting
- Own the integrated transformation plan across multiple workstreams and sponsors
- Track benefits realisation, risks, dependencies, and milestones
- Provide clear, executive-level reporting and insights to senior stakeholders
- Drive consistency in delivery methodologies, tools, and cadence
- Act as a critical partner to programme sponsors, workstream leads, and leadership
Key Skills & Experience
- Proven experience leading PMO functions within large-scale transformation programmes
- Strong stakeholder management at executive level
- Expertise in programme governance, planning, and benefits management
- Highly analytical with excellent communication and influencing skills
- Comfortable operating in complex, fast-changing environments
Success Measures
- Delivery of transformation milestones and benefits
- High-quality, trusted reporting and decision support
- Strong governance with minimal delivery friction
Benefits
- Pension scheme (8% company contribution / 4% personal contribution)
- 25 days paid annual leave
